Ezra A. Carman to Napoleon J. T. Dana, 23 September 1895
War Department,
Antietam Battlefield Commission,
Washington,
Sep 23 1895.
Gen N.J.T. Dana
Bureau of Pensions
Dear General
Yours of 17th to Gen Heth has been referred to me. the error pointed out by you in having the 20th New York instead of 42nd New York in your brigade organization was a clerical error, and was perpetuated in the casting on the [?]. It had been noted and a new [?] ordered, meanwhile, the number has been cut off and the correct regiment temporarily painted on. We note what you say regarding the position of your brigade. Our papers are all at Sharpsburg but in a few days we shall have them and will communicate with you as to the data upon which we located the position of your brigade line.
Very respectfully
E. A. Carman
